Output 586a256cd80e28c8d17d4573904b67ec4095c28e61e27aedd8abf2cfc1698d9d:0

value
42440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8a00e8f63281d643d4a1f54bbb4f4e8b0775fec OP_EQUAL
address
3Nu2RzfhQBxE6VkbCekzFb4RMzyoNEeQm4
transaction
586a256cd80e28c8d17d4573904b67ec4095c28e61e27aedd8abf2cfc1698d9d
spent
true